How much do business process automation j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for business process automation in California is $106,504.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,400.00 and $128,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a business process automation?

A Business Process Automation (BPA) job focuses on using technology to streamline and optimize business processes by reducing manual effort, increasing efficiency, and minimizing errors. Professionals in this field analyze workflows, identify automation opportunities, and implement tools such as robotic process automation (RPA), artificial intelligence (AI), and workflow automation software. They collaborate with different departments to improve operational efficiency and ensure business goals are met. The role requires a mix of technical expertise, problem-solving skills, and process improvement knowledge to enhance productivity across an organ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in business process automation?

To thrive in Business Process Automation, you need strong analytical skills, process mapping expertise, and a background in business management or information technology. Familiarity with automation tools such as UiPath, Blue Prism, Automation Anywhere, or BPM software, as well as relevant certifications like Certified Business Process Professional (CBPP), is highly valued. Excellent problem-solving abilities, communication, and project management skills help set candidates apart in this dynamic field. These competencies enable professionals to design and implement effective automation solutions that drive organizational efficiency and continuous improvement.

What does a business process automation do?

Professionals in Business Process Automation typically spend their days analyzing existing business workflows, identifying opportunities for efficiency gains, and designing automation solutions using specialized software platforms. They collaborate closely with stakeholders from IT, operations, and business units to gather requirements and ensure the seamless integration of automation tools. Regular tasks may include process documentation, system testing, troubleshooting automation issues, and training end-users on new systems. This role often involves managing multiple projects simultaneously and adapting to changing business needs, making a proactive and detail-oriented approach essential for success.

Job description

Redwood Credit Union is seeking an Automation Analyst II, who will be responsible for the analysis, design and implementation of advanced enterprise automation solutions that leverage Robotic Process Automation (RPA), AI-driven workflows, and Microsoft Copilot technologies. This role serves as a technical leader in automation initiatives, focusing heavily on integrating AI capabilities such as Copilot agents, intelligent document processing, decisioning, and natural language interfaces into business workflows.

The Automation Analyst II partners closely with business stakeholders, IT teams, and vendors to identify automation opportunities, architect intelligent solutions, and deliver scalable, secure, and reliable automations across the organization. This role requires a strong balance of technical expertise, analytical thinking, and business process understanding, and operates with minimal supervision.
 
Key Responsibilities
Advanced Automation Analysis & Solution Design:
o Lead end-to-end lifecycle of automation initiatives, including process discovery, feasibility analysis, solution architecture, development, testing, deployment, and ongoing support.
o Analyze complex business processes and independently evaluate and recommend AI-first and automation-first solutions, incorporating Microsoft Copilot agents, AI prompts and orchestration, RPA (UiPath preferred), workflow and API-based integrations.
o Serve as a subject matter expert for intelligent automation, mentoring Automation Analyst I staff and providing direction on solution design reviews.
o Collaborate with functional and technical stakeholders to translate business requirements into strategic and scalable automation solutions that improve organizational operations.
o Develop detailed technical documentation, solution designs, workflows, and governance artifacts.
AI & Copilot-Focused Automation:
Design and oversee implementation of AI-enhanced automations, including:
o Copilot agents and copiloted workflows.
o Intelligent document processing and OCR.
o AI-assisted decision logic and exception handling.
o Natural language interaction layers for business users.
o Integrate Microsoft Copilot capabilities with existing RPA platforms (UiPath) and enterprise systems.
o Ensure AI automations are secure, compliant, explainable, and auditable, in alignment with internal policies.
o Continuously evaluate and recommend enhancements using emerging AI capabilities within the Microsoft ecosystem.
Robotic Process Automation (RPA) Development:
o Design, develop, and maintain UiPath automations and orchestrations at an enterprise scale.
o Create reusable components, frameworks, and shared libraries to improve development efficiency and consistency.
o Monitor automation performance, reliability, and throughput, resolving issues and optimizing workflows.
o Lead testing, validation, and deployment strategies for production automations.
o Coordinate upgrades, version changes, and platform enhancements across RPA and AI tooling; advise of system improvements.
Operations, Monitoring & Support:
o Provide advanced technical support for automation and AI workflows, including production issue resolution and root cause analysis.
o Maintain automation service logs, metrics, and performance dashboards.
o Ensure workflows execute accurately, securely, and on schedule (daily, weekly, month-end, and critical business cycles).
o Review and manage access controls, user security, and encryption standards for automation platforms.
o Interact with third-party vendors and consultants supporting AI, RPA, and workflow systems.
Governance, Quality & Best Practices:
o Establish and enforce automation development standards, QA protocols, and AI governance guidelines.
o Ensure automations meet enterprise standards for security, data privacy, logging, and compliance.
o Participate in automation roadmap planning and continuous improvement initiatives, while influencing long-term strategy.
o Act as an internal advisor to business units on process optimization to identify and eliminate inefficiencies, redundancies, and manual work through intelligent automation.
